# initialize the image to plot as correction goes
fig = make_subplots(rows=4, cols=1)
## Calculate high order polynomial
df = pd.read_csv(basePath+"/data.csv")
df = df.groupby(["SetVolts"], as_index=False).mean(numeric_only=True)
# compensate for offset error around 0 -> this is cal error instead of INL
df["RefVolts"] = df["RefVolts"] - df.loc[df['SetVolts'] == 0]["RefVolts"].iloc[0]
df["DutVolts"] = df["DutVolts"] - df.loc[df['SetVolts'] == 0]["DutVolts"].iloc[0]
# get 1st order to 10V -> 10V gain error, this is cal error instead of INL, -10 could be due to INL.
# this is heavily dependant on cal procedure, say 7V is the reference calibration point
alphaRef = df.loc[df['SetVolts'] == 10]["RefVolts"].iloc[0]/10
alphaDut = df.loc[df['SetVolts'] == 10]["DutVolts"].iloc[0]/10
# remove 1st order to get the INL
df["RefVolts"] = df["RefVolts"] - alphaRef*df['SetVolts']
df["DutVolts"] = df["DutVolts"] - alphaDut*df['SetVolts']
df["DutToRefVolts"] = df['DutVolts'] - df["RefVolts"]
# plot INL of calibrator
fig.add_trace(go.Scatter(x=df['SetVolts'], y=df["RefVolts"],mode='lines+markers',name='Original REF INL'),row=1, col=1)
fig.add_trace(go.Scatter(x=df['SetVolts'], y=df["DutVolts"],mode='lines+markers',name='Original DUT INL'),row=1, col=1)
fig.add_trace(go.Scatter(x=df['SetVolts'], y=df["DutToRefVolts"],mode='lines+markers',name='DUT vs REF'),row=2, col=1)
